There in his gloomy chambers, supposedly secure against surprise, Ebenezer Scrooge is about to have Christmas Eve company – and there’s not a caroler in the bunch. Four ghostly visitors usher him into the most horrifying nightmare he’s ever seen…his own wretched life of utter-selfishness.
Come along on his journey with the Ghosts of Christmas Past, Present, and Future, all of whom attempt to point Scrooge onto a virtuous path. Meet the most notable characters ever introduced in literature: Bob Cratchit, angelic Tiny Tim, and good-natured Fred. 'A Christmas Carol' will enrapture both the young and old with a vital lesson on hope and benevolence for humanity.
Recorded locally with some old and new faces from LACT's stage, this old fashioned radio broadcast will inspire your imagination and remind your family that it’s never too late to change for the better.
